Specifications

The Polar Ware Griffin Beakers, Stainless Steel 4000B is engineered for serious utility, boasting a generous 4000 mL capacity. Its dimensions, measuring 15.6 x 22.5 cm (6 1/8 x 8 7/8 inches), provide a substantial volume without becoming unwieldy. The construction is entirely stainless steel, a material chosen for its inherent strength and inertness.

These specifications are not just numbers; they translate directly into tangible benefits for the user. The massive 4000 mL capacity means it can handle large batches, reducing the frequency of refills and saving valuable time in demanding situations. Its robust stainless steel build ensures it can withstand rough handling, high temperatures, and chemical exposure without degradation, making it suitable for a wide range of critical applications.

Durability & Maintenance

Longevity is a hallmark of the Polar Ware Griffin Beakers, Stainless Steel 4000B. Constructed from high-grade stainless steel, it is virtually impervious to rust, chipping, or peeling, meaning it is built to last for years, if not decades, of hard use. Its robust construction means it can handle significant impacts and temperature fluctuations.

Maintenance is refreshingly simple. A quick wash with soap and water is usually sufficient for everyday cleaning. For tougher residues or dried-on materials, a mild abrasive pad can be used without fear of scratching the surface or compromising its integrity. This ease of maintenance is a critical advantage in field environments where rigorous cleaning facilities may not be readily available.
